centOS7 下安裝 JDK
阿新 • • 發佈:2021-11-03
1、解除安裝 centOS 自帶 JDK
解除安裝 centos7 自帶的 jdk 通過以下命令檢視是否已經安裝jdk
yum list installed |grep java
或者如下命令都可以
whereis java
find / -name java
如果安裝了則通過以下命令刪除
yum -y remove java
2、安裝jdk
下面通過兩種方式安裝 JDK,分別用 yun 安裝和離線安裝。
其中,yun 安裝也是 centos 比較常用的安裝方法,也是系統自帶的安裝方式。
2.1 方式一 yun 安裝 JDK
以下命令查詢能夠安裝的 jdk 版本
yum -y list java*
找到對應版本後通過以下命令安裝jdk1.8
yum install java-1.8.0-openjdk.x86_64 java-1.8.0-openjdk-devel.x86_64
通過以下命令檢視jdk是否安裝完成
java -version
使用 yum 方式安裝 jdk 後,將 OpenJDK 安裝到 /usr/lib/jvm/ 目錄,使用如下命令檢視
ls /usr/lib/jvm/
2.2 方式二 離線安裝JDK
下載 JDK
官網下載想要的 JDK 版本,下面提供官網最新版下載地址和歷史版本下載地址。
注意:在這裡不要通過複製下載連結然後在伺服器上使用wget下載,因為這裡下載到的是未同意認證協議的版本,最後在伺服器上是無法解壓的,可以在windows下載好了之後傳到伺服器上。
解壓 JDK
現將下載好的jdk安裝包,tar.gz包上傳到對應目錄上,可以用ftp或者命令上傳即可,然後解壓。
當前是上傳到 /usr/local/ 這個目錄下,然後解壓。
tar -zxvf jdk-8u144-linux-x64.tar.gz
解壓後的目錄如下。
/usr/local/jdk1.8.0_211
3、配置環境變數
不管用什麼方式安裝 JDK ,均用如下方式配置環境變數。
輸入命令,編輯如下檔案。
vi /etc/profile
在文字內容最後新增如下:【注】:CentOS6上面的是JAVAHOME,CentOS7是{JAVA_HOME}
#java environment export JAVA_HOME=/usr/local/jdk1.8.0_211 #其中這行,需要改成你安裝的實際路徑,其它不用改。 export CLASSPATH=.:${JAVA_HOME}/jre/lib/rt.jar:${JAVA_HOME}/lib/dt.jar:${JAVA_HOME}/lib/tools.jar export PATH=$PATH:${JAVA_HOME}/bin
儲存並退出編輯。
讓設定的環境變數生效
source /etc/profile
檢查是否配置成功
java -version
檢視配置的環境變數是否正確
echo $JAVA_HOME
echo $CLASSPATH
echo $PATH
讀後感
來這裡找我交流
- QQ群:330374464
- 公眾號:軟體測試資源站(ID:testpu)
- CSDN:https://blog.csdn.net/mcfnhm
- 語雀:https://www.yuque.com/testpu/pro